How to make it

  • PREHEAT grill to medium heat. Shape meat into 8 thin patties. Cover each of 4 of the patties with 1 Tbsp. feta cheese; top with second patty. Pinch edges of patties together to seal.
  • PLACE on grill. Grill 7 to 9 minutes on each side or until cooked through.
  • FILL rolls with patties.
